BAGASBAS BEACH

Considered as one of the best surfing sites in the Philippines, Bagasbas is the most popular beach resort in the province of Camarines Norte. The easiest break to get to, just 50 minutes by air from Manila, a lot of surfers would flock to the beach on weekends. The surf breaks left and right on a sand bar with swells rising three to six feet and on a good day can reach to as high as eight feet, perfect for beginners and experienced surfers alike.

Located in the town of Daet, Bagasbas Beach has undergone a huge transformation from being a trash infested sand trap; it has been turned to a clean and safe haven for recreation for people in the nearby communities. The town of Daet itself has a relaxed pace. Even as the capital of the province, the town has welcome feel and encourages visitors to tour the town and relax away from the pressures of the city and take part of the excellent seafood and the local cuisine, one of the best in the country.

The beach has a long and wide expanse of fine gray sand. During clear but windy days, the big waves that roll in from the Pacific Ocean make it a paradise for surfing beginners and aficionados. The break's sandy bottom and generally uncrowded lineups combine to make a comfortable session for surfers of any level. During typhoon swells, Bagasbas Beach has been known to provide barrels. The current can be quite strong during bigger conditions. Swimmers and waders provide a bulk of the water traffic and care must be given close to shore, where children make a game of avoiding the oncoming boards.

For a relaxed and economic vacation, Bagasbas Beach is perfect for those who want peace and quiet rather than the hustle and bustle of tourist resorts.
